Tracy Sanders Rucker, Esq.

Tracy Sanders, Esq. is an accomplished attorney, author, and speaker in Los Angeles. Tracy Sanders Rucker, Esq., is a national continuing legal education (CLE) faculty and business law consultant focusing on labor and employment law, immigration law, and corporate compliance. As Founder of Natural Hair and the Law, she develops and delivers courses addressing employment discrimination, workforce development, and post diversity, equity, and inclusion (DEI) legislation audits. Her work bridges legal advocacy and employment practice, helping employers and counsel align business operations with civil rights and professional standards. Ms. Sanders has been honored with several prestigious awards. She received the United States Congresswoman/California Senator Sydney Kamlager Sister Circle Award and a Certificate of Special Recognition from United States Congresswoman/Mayor of Los Angeles Karen Bass for her outstanding community service. Ms. Sanders received the Netflix Business Award, Ebay Up & Running California Program, and Comerica Bank Los Angeles Lakers Women’s Business Award. Ms. Sanders has been a featured speaker at Yale University, LA Law Library, Corporate Counsel Women of Color Conference, Arizona State University College of Law, Loyola Law School, Thurgood Marshall School of Law, and Alpha Kappa Alpha Sorority Leadership Seminar. Ms. Sanders appeared on TV networks such as ABC, CNBC, FOX, MSNBC, TLC, and WE. She hosted a podcast, Legal Talk With Tracy Sanders. Ms. Sanders earned a Bachelor of Arts in Political Science at the University of South Carolina, Master of Public Administration at the University of South Carolina, Juris Doctorate at Syracuse University College of Law, and Women's Entrepreneurship Certificate at Cornell University. Ms. Sanders joined the American Bar Association, American Society for Public Administration, and Black Women Lawyers Association of Los Angeles. She established the Attorney Tracy Sanders Foundation to help youths achieve their education and career goals.
